Injection molding is a tool decision first and a piece-price decision second. Choose the operating model before you compare listed plants.
| When this is the job | Use | Why |
|---|---|---|
| A design that still has to change, or a few hundred parts to learn from | Prototype or bridge molder | You are buying speed and change, not a tool that has to last 500,000 shots. |
| A released part with annual volume and a packaged-delivery assumption | Production molder | The award is process control, cavitation, and tool life — not first-article heroics. |
| A new tool that has to be designed, built, and sampled before production | Mold maker, or a molder that owns tool build | The first deliverable is a tool that can run, not a box of parts. |

Start with resin, press fit, and whether the quote is prototype or production. Then compare tool ownership, cavitation, and validation. Listed counts show who is in the directory. They do not prove current press time.
A 3D model with draft, resin grade, color, quantity, tool-ownership terms, and cosmetic or dimensional acceptance. Missing tool life or validation assumptions is why piece prices cannot be compared.
Not automatically. A molder runs a tool. A mold maker builds one. Some listed companies do both. The RFQ should say which work you are buying.
